"I thought there was always this IT motto that "for anything important, keep minimum three independent copies, minimum one off-site"."

It's been a few years since I've used CrashPlan in a different role, but we used it for end user laptops.

In theory they were supposed to backup everything important to dedicated file shares that were then backed up as part of the standard company backup policy (disk-to-disk-to-tape).

Only many of the users that we were trying to protect didn't come into the office due to travel or working at customer sites, would forget to VPN in/manually start backups from home and if there were in the office, it was only for meetings, so CrashPlan was a life saver if laptops were lost/stolen/destroyed.

Horses for courses...
